Specifying width of table cells?

Is there a way to specify the width of a table cell? To Speak as a Dragon would be much more readable if the first three columns were all set to some fixed value, while the fourth column was allowed to size to the screen. I want the table column widths uniform, in other words. -- Sigrdrifa 16:55, October 11, 2009 (UTC)

In the first row, for each cell you can add the width like this:
|width="100px"|This is the first cell||width="50%"|This is the second cell||width="80px"||This is the third cell
Basically, you can add any parameters after you start the cell (be it with | on a new line or || if it's multiple cells on one line) and then use a single | to designate them as parameters and after that | you put all the text. -- lordebon 17:13, October 11, 2009 (UTC)

Actually you can do it to the header row and affect everything in the column. So, the answer is yes there is but with caveats. First, consider the browsers that people are using to view the information. While Internet Exploder (yes I'm biased against it) provides a great deal of our traffic, we have at least 5 other browser types to consider and each handles tables in a slightly different way. The in-game browser in particular is important. Second, consider as well how tables change (if at all) when a user is specifically not logged in. Now, in answer to your exact question, in the wiki tables on the quest you specified, say you wanted to make the Rune column a fixed width. In the table, you'd look for the line that was the header for Rune. (right now it's |'''Rune''' ). Before that header information you'd place the size indicator and follow it with a pipe character. So, if you wanted the Rune column to always be 200 pixels wide, the line would look like style="width:200px"|'''Rune''' . If you'd like more information on the use of tables, I recommend the Wikipedia help article . It has lots of examples of how things can be manipulated.-- Kodia 17:15, October 11, 2009 (UTC)

Thanks! I set the first three columns at 15%, that should give it the most flexibility on any browser. -- Sigrdrifa 18:49, October 11, 2009 (UTC)

Search function?

I've noticed that the search function has been completely broken for a couple of days now. Is there any fix for this on its way?

Simple check: http://eq2.wikia.com/wiki/Special:Search?search=fiery (i.e. manually searching for "fiery", which could return the quest to convert your epic weapon has no hits whatsoever). it seems like you can only access pages via search, if you enter their exact name within the search field, i.e. entering Epic directly leads you to the Epic disambiguation page -- Zarbryn 21:09, August 31, 2010 (UTC)

I believe this is how the search function usually works; it's not broken, merely not operating how a lot of people expect it to (me included). Searching for "fiery" returns all the pages for fiery. Searching for "epic" returns the page we have called " epic ," which we've linked to several other pages because it's a common search term. You can help us improve the page by adding other links that might be useful. If you were looking to search for the term "epic" and receive a list of pages that were related to that specific word (not the disambiguation page), then the best choice would be to click on the Advanced Search link instead of using the Search This Wiki search function. The advanced search ignores the default pages that match your search term. Using the advanced search feature for "epic" would return this page .-- Kodia 22:08, August 31, 2010 (UTC)
